Lower School Academic Support Teacher (Part-time)

The Covenant School, an independent Christian Liberal Arts & Sciences school in Charlottesville, Virginia, is seeking a dedicated educator to serve as a part‑time Academic Support Teacher in the Lower School beginning in the 2026‑27 school year. Our school, which serves over 750 students from Pre‑K through Grade 12, is a gospel‑centered community of faith and learning committed to the formation of the whole person through a rich and humane education.

Faculty at The Covenant School understand teaching as a Christian vocation. They take personal responsibility for students’ intellectual, spiritual, and personal development and work together to cultivate a community of scholars in which students are known, loved, and appropriately challenged.

Position Overview

The Lower School Academic Support Teacher provides targeted academic support to students in K through Grade 5, helping strengthen foundational literacy, math and executive functioning skills through small‑group and individualized instruction. Working closely with classroom teachers, families, and the Lower School support team, the Academic Support Teacher administers assessments, monitors student progress, supports intervention plans, and provides coordinated support aligned with classroom instruction. Through clear, structured teaching and careful observation, the teacher helps students grow in confidence, independence, and effective learning habits while supporting their continued success within the classroom.

We are seeking an educator who is committed to the holistic formation of children and who approaches this work with joy, patience, and attentiveness. The Academic Support Teacher builds meaningful relationships with students while collaborating closely with teachers and parents to support a range of learning needs. The role requires thoughtful communication, organization, and ongoing professional growth in literacy/math intervention and student support. In keeping with the school’s mission, the Academic Support Teacher integrates Christian faith naturally and thoughtfully into daily interactions with students, helping cultivate perseverance, confidence, and care for others within the learning process.
